The inelastic scattering of the brane fields induced by $t$-channel gravireggeons exchanges in the RS model with a small curvature $\kappa$ is considered, and the imaginary part of the eikonal is analytically calculated. It is demonstrated that the results can be obtained from the corresponding formulae previously derived in the ADD model with one extra dimension of the size $R_c$ by formal replacement $R_c \to (\pi \kappa)^{-1}$. The inelastic cross section for the scattering of ultra-high neutrino off the nucleon is numerically estimated for the case $\kappa \ll \bar{M}_5 \sim 1$ TeV, where $\bar{M}_5$ is a reduced Planck scale in five warped dimensions.
